Dateoffset python

WebAdding Dateoffset to current date and time. tm=pd.Timestamp ('now') # current timestamp x=pd.offsets.DateOffset (years=1,months=2,days=3,\ hours=4,minutes=40,seconds=20) … WebJun 17, 2024 · I want to create next empty 24 rows for 24 months for prediction My code: from pandas.tseries.offsets import DateOffset future_dates = [df.index [-1] + DateOffset (months = x) for x in range (0,24)] TypeError: unsupported operand type (s) for +: 'int' and 'DateOffset'. Please include a sample initialized dataframe and the full traceback of the ...

Calculate monthly percentage change of daily basis data in Python

WebDec 29, 2024 · Doing. #takes input value. datevalue = pd.to_datetime (input ("Enter shift: ")) #shifts dates from the datevalue input - However I would like d variable to only be applied to the rows that contain [type] == 'aa'. #apply e variable to rows that contain [type] = 'bb'. WebMar 25, 2014 · 2 Answers. Sorted by: 39. Use the "D" offset rather than "M" and specifically use "30D" for 30 days or approximately one month. df = df.rolling ("30D").sum () Initially, I intuitively jumped to using "M" as I figured it stands for one month, but now it's clear why that doesn't work. Share. how to say 1957 in french https://luniska.com

python - Python 日期時間到 Azure Edm.DateTimeOffset - 堆棧內 …

WebMar 9, 2015 · you can use DateOffset: >>> df = pd.DataFrame (np.random.randn (6),index=dates,columns=list ('A')) >>> df.index = df.index + pd.DateOffset (days=15) … WebPython 从年到月和周的日期偏移,python,date,datetime,pandas,dataframe,Python,Date,Datetime,Pandas,Dataframe. ... … WebAug 27, 2024 · You could use DateOffset as freq: month_starts.shift(freq = pd.DateOffset(years = 1)) Gives: ... python; pandas; datetime; or ask your own question. The Overflow Blog How to keep the servers running when your Mastodon goes viral. From Web2 to Web3: How developers can upskill and build with blockchain ... how to say 190 in spanish snpmar23

Python 从年到月和周的日期偏 …

Category:Date offsets — pandas 2.0.0 documentation

Tags:Dateoffset python

Dateoffset python

python - Pandas Using Frequencies to Offset Date - Stack Overflow

WebDec 9, 2013 · 5. One quick mention. if you are using data-frames and your datatype is datetime64 [ns] non indexed, Then I would go as below: Assuming the date column name is 'Date to Change by 1' and you want to change all dates by 1 day. import time from datetime import datetime, timedelta, date, time before ['Date to Change by 1'] = 1/31/2024 df … WebSep 8, 2024 · It returns True if the given DateOffset is onOffset from the passed date else it return False. Syntax: pandas.tseries.offsets.DateOffset.onOffset () Parameter : None Returns : boolean. Example #1: Use pandas.tseries.offsets.DateOffset.onOffset () function to check if the passed date is onOffset for the given DateOffset. Python3.

Dateoffset python

Did you know?

To test if a date is in the set of a DateOffset dateOffset we can use the is_on_offset method: dateOffset.is_on_offset(date). If a date is not on a valid date, the rollback and rollforward methods can be used to roll the date to the nearest valid date before/after the date. WebSep 8, 2024 · Dateoffsets are a standard kind of date increment used for a date range in Pandas. It works exactly like relativedelta in terms of the keyword args we pass in. …

WebFeb 28, 2024 · To get the last date of the month we do something like this: from datetime import date, timedelta import calendar last_day = date.today ().replace (day=calendar.monthrange (date.today ().year, date.today ().month) [1]) Now to explain what we are doing here we will break it into two parts: WebSep 11, 2024 · Python Server Side Programming Programming To create a DateOffset, use the DateOffset () method in Pandas. Set the Increment value as an argument. At …

WebOct 10, 2024 · Python3. new_timestamp = ts + bd. print(new_timestamp) Output : As we can see in the output, we have successfully created an offset of 5 Business days and added it to the given timestamp. Example #2 : Use pandas.tseries.offsets.BusinessDay () function to create an offset of 10 Business days and 10 hours. Python3. import pandas as pd. WebJan 1, 2024 · 1 Answer Sorted by: 3 Use months instead month for add value 1, not replace, thank you @splash58: print (t + pd.DateOffset (months=1) == t) False Details: print (t + …

WebPerformanceWarning: Non-vectorized DateOffset being applied to Series or DatetimeIndex. python; pandas; datetimeindex; Share. Improve this question. Follow asked Sep 15, 2016 at 17:05. piRSquared piRSquared. 282k 57 57 gold badges 470 470 silver badges 615 615 bronze badges.

WebJan 21, 2024 · Sorted by: 2. You can do the following: # set to timestamp df ['date'] = pd.to_datetime (df ['date']) # create a future date df ftr = (df ['date'] + pd.Timedelta (4, unit='days')).to_frame () ftr ['Monthly Value'] = None # join the future data df1 = pd.concat ( [df, ftr], ignore_index=True) date Monthly Value 0 2001-02-01 100 1 2001-02-02 200 2 ... how to say 1994 in spanishWebDec 24, 2024 · To offset the index by a day: df. index + pd. Timedelta ("1D") DatetimeIndex ( ['2024-12-25', '2024-12-27'], dtype='datetime64 [ns]', freq=None) filter_none. Note … northfield linesWebNov 10, 2024 · Reason is different columns names, solution is converting df[['A1', 'B1']] to numpy array:. df[['A1', 'B1']] = df[['A', 'B']].shift(freq=pd.DateOffset(months=1 ... how to say 1975 in spanishWeb如何將格式為 : : . 的字符串轉換為日期時間偏移感知字符串。 我從 cosmosdb 數據庫中獲取此值並嘗試將其插入搜索服務中。 得到錯誤為 我猜 output 應該是以下格式.. 我想使用 … how to say 1993 in frenchWebApr 28, 2024 · Python Pandas tseries.offsets.DateOffset用法介绍. Dateoffsets是用于Pandas中日期范围的一种标准日期增量。就传入的关键字args而言, 它的工作方式与relativedelta完全相同。DateOffets的工作方式如下, 每个偏移量指定一组符合DateOffset的日期。例如, Bday将此集合定义为工作日 (MF)的 ... northfield lines carletonWebDec 26, 2012 · How can I apply an offset on the current time in python? In other terms, be able to get the current time minus x hours and/or minus m minutes and/or minus s secondes and/or minus ms milliseconds. for instance. curent time = 18:26:00.000 offset = 01:10:00.000 =>resulting time = 17:16:00.000 python; how to say 1979 in spanish googleWebSelecting the last week of each month only from a data frame - Python/Pandas. 0. Concat dataframes/series with axis=1 in a loop. 1. Pandas dataframe Groupby and retrieve date range. 0. Pandas Dataframe: Based a column of dates, create new column with last day of the month? 0. how to combine year and month column and add a date. northfield lines promo code